The 2005 Mini-14 is the "new and improved" version. Somewhat different from the old rifle, said to be made on new machinery. Main differences I can see are the shape of the reciever and the iron sights. Prices were raised accordingly.

Quoted:

Quoted:
This guy is selling LEO Ruger Mini-14 GB's for $749:
kaneohegs.com/inventory_rifles.htm

kaneohegs.com/images/ruger_ranch_GB_LE.jpg






must be a new style. My GB has the integrated front sight/bayonet lug.



It is.  They changed the GB when they changed the Mini-14.  The GB now has integrated scope mounts, the new sights, and have dropped the bayonet lug.
